My opinion: More than possible with VLC Player.

Let's look at our topology:

Camera-> Live Output-> Capture Card-> VLC Player-> Streaming-> LAN -> VLC Player (doesn't have to be) -> Beamer

That should work. I can't help you out with details for now. I also have to look them up by myself. VLC let's you select your inputs for streaming. You can select a capture device and audio input. The audio input can be very helpful if you take the final mixdown of the show as input.

Let's say you display your videos over a beamer. Beamers should have monitoring output too! So let's set up a media switch in front of the capturing pc. The inputs for the switch would be your camera and your beamer.

Camera___|
|----> SWITCH ---> PC capturing inputs ----> VLC [...]
Beamer __|

You could switch live between a camera that is set to the moderator AND between the high quality AMVs. ISN'T THAT AWESOME!!!???

The possibilities are enormous. You can even make live webstreams that could be hooked up by ANY device.

Canon make good cameras. It works with any camera that has monitoring output. However Canon HDSLRs won't work because of the ~12 min clip restriction (unless you have Magic Lantern on it, than you can somehow avoid it without capturing the video and only outputting in via HDMI).
